Mark of Expertise: The PE Stamp's Significance in Architecture
In the intricate world of architecture, where design combines form and function, certain elements hold paramount importance. Among these, the Professional Engineer (PE) stamp stands as a beacon of trust, signifying expertise and adherence to rigorous standards. This unmistakable mark, borne by licensed engineers, serves as a pledge of competence in structural design and construction. When affixed to architectural drawings, it authenticates the engineer's involvement, assuring clients and stakeholders that the plans have been thoroughly reviewed for safety, stability, and compliance with building codes.
The PE stamp is not merely a formality; it represents a commitment to ethical conduct and professional responsibility. here Architects who partner with licensed engineers bearing this stamp gain assurance in the structural integrity of their designs, ultimately contributing to the creation of safe and durable buildings.
